The reaction of [Ru(tpy)Cl3] with the potentially cyclometallating ligand 6-phenyl-2,2'-bipyridine (HL) has been examined in a variety of solvents. In glacial acetic acid the ligand acts as a substituted 2,2'-bipyridine and reacts to give the complex cation [Ru(tpy)(HL)Cl]+, containing a bidentate N,N'-bonded HL ligand. The structure of this complex has been unambiguously established from its H-1 NMR spectrum. In contrast, the use of water as a solvent gives the cyclometallated complex cation [Ru(tpy)(L)]+. In methanol and butan-1-ol, mixtures of these two products are formed. The work has been extended to 2,2':6',2''-terpyridines with aromatic substituents in the 4' position and the complexes have been characterised by H-1 NMR, electronic and FAB mass spectroscopic techniques and also by cyclic voltammetry.
